#include <bits/stdc++.h> using namespace std; int main(){ int n,r = 0; cin >> n; stack<int> s({(int)1e9+1}); for (int i(0),x;i < n;++i){ cin >> x; while(s.top()<=x) r += (s.size()%2?1:-1)*s.top(),s.pop(); if (s.size()%2!=i%2) s.emplace(x),r += (i%2?-1:1)*x; cout << r << endl; } }